Collapse (Why Societies Choose to Fail or Succeed)

"Collapse" by Jared Diamond explores why some societies prosper while others fail. It identifies key factors: environmental damage, climate change, hostile neighbors, declining relationships with allies, and the society’s own choices. Societies often falter when they ignore how their actions—like overusing resources—harm their environment, or when they fail to adapt to changing circumstances. Success depends on the ability to recognize problems early, make wise decisions, and act collectively to avoid disaster. The book emphasizes that societies are vulnerable but can also learn and change to avoid collapse.
